Does anyone here know of a way to add cvars to the mapcycle file for 'Soldier of Fortune II' in Cortex? I've been running SOF2 servers for a long time, but I've only been using Cortex for a few months now. I've tried manually uploading and replacing the "server.mapcycle" file that Cortex creates by default, but it eventually just overwrites it with the default one it created, which doesn't contain any special cvars.

Here's some of the special cvars I'm referring to, which I would like to include in my mapcycle file:

Before I started using Cortex, I used the cvars above in my mapcycle. I did this, because I prefer to use different settings on certain maps.

Does anyone know of a way to accomplish what I described?

If not, would it be possible to impliment this into a future release of Cortex?

Right now this isn't possible in Cortex. The only way to do this would be to upload your own mapcycle file. I'll see what we can do about it though for Cortex.

Thanks for the reply. Uploading my own custom mapcycle only seems to work temporarily, because Cortex eventually overwrites it with the default one it creates. Maybe as a solution, you could add a field in Cortex to designate the name of the mapcycle file you want to use? In which case the admin would just name their custom mapcycle file something other than "server.mapcycle". Maybe taking it a step further, when doing this, you could also allow the "Edit Maps" module for this game to be disabled so that Cortex wouldn't actively try to force it's own default mapcycle file?
